Optimizing Your Periodontal Narratives

Strong Dentrix Perio Charting documentation must bridge the gap between the numeric chart and the clinical narrative. A complete note should include the patient's chief complaint regarding gum health, the specific probe depths observed, the presence of bleeding on probing (BOP), and the clinician's assessment of plaque and calculus levels. It should also clearly document the patient's response to the findings and the agreed-upon treatment plan, such as scaling and root planing (SRP) or a referral to a periodontist.
